2

根据Symfony 最佳实践

Store your assets in the assets/ directory at the root of your project.

但目前,我没有创建这个文件夹,如果我创建它,我收到错误消息,告诉我找不到资源。

我试过composer require webassets,但不工作。

有人有解决方案吗?

问候

4

3 回答 3

2

将资产文件夹放在根目录中是最佳做法。无法从外部访问根目录的原因。你应该试试 Symfony 的 Webpack Encore 插件。它将您的最小化和压缩资产编译到公用文件夹中,因此它们永远不会显示为原始文件。

如果这不符合您的兴趣,只需将您的整个资产文件夹放入公共目录。

于 2018-08-08T09:37:01.647 回答
0
  1. 启用安可composer require encore
  2. 更新纱线yarn install
于 2020-02-12T10:31:02.893 回答
0

您尝试以下命令。

$ composer require encore
$ yarn install

可以参考这里。
http://symfony.com/doc/current/frontend/encore/installation.html

于 2018-01-08T02:47:47.917 回答